The formula for mass is simple: mass = density x volume. Density is a measure of how much mass is packed into a given volume of a substance, and it's usually expressed in units like grams per cubic centimeter (g/cm³) or kilograms per liter (kg/L). Volume, on the other hand, is the amount of space an object occupies. By multiplying these two values, we get the mass of the object.
